Output 66926d1e8ea2fcb1763727205929bcfbbedb2538b3a963be22c119a616502194:1

value
144982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 362c904fd40ddb3bc0d5e4274aa5c970efbaa973 OP_EQUAL
address
36dToF77DaPiGtUMMbWgAsbLiRDtE5GppP
transaction
66926d1e8ea2fcb1763727205929bcfbbedb2538b3a963be22c119a616502194
spent
true